In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
net/mlx5e: Fix eswitch mode block underflow on IPsec acquire SA
mlx5e xfrm add state() handles acquire-flow temporary SAs by allocating software state and skipping hardware offload setup.
That path jumps to the common success label before taking the eswitch mode block. After tunnel-mode validation was moved earlier, the common success label unconditionally calls mlx5 eswitch unblock mode(). For acquire SAs, this decrements esw->offloads.num block mode without a matching increment.
Return directly after installing the acquire SA offload handle, so only the paths that successfully called mlx5 eswitch block mode() call the matching unblock.
